Brief: Discover the ASTM E906 FAA Combustion Chamber, designed to test the heat release rate of aircraft materials. This tester ensures compliance with FAR 25.853 requirements, featuring a radiant heat flux of 35 kW/m2. Ideal for aerospace safety standards, it includes advanced components like silicon carbide elements and a stainless steel chamber.
Related Product Features:
Stainless steel combustion test chamber with high-temperature glass observation window.
Four Glowbars heating rods providing 35 kW/m2 heat radiation flux.
Dual PID temperature controllers for precise heating control.
Fully automatic pneumatic sample propulsion and shielding door device.
Upper and lower burners with adjustable gas flow via rotor flowmeter.
Water-cooled heat flow meter for accurate heat radiation measurement.
Data acquisition system with heat release standard test software.
Complies with FAA, Airbus, Boeing, and ASTM E906 standards.
FAQ's:
What standards does the ASTM E906 FAA Combustion Chamber comply with?
It complies with FAR Part 25 Appendix F Part IV, FAA Aircraft Materials Fire Test Handbook, Boeing BSS 7322, Airbus AITM 2.0006, and ASTM E906.
What is the heat flux density provided by the tester?
The tester provides a radiant heat flux of 35±0.5 kW/m2 to ensure compliance with FAR 25.853 requirements.
What are the installation requirements for the ASTM E906 FAA Combustion Chamber?
It requires indoor installation, a 220V60A power supply, methane gas with 99% purity, and auxiliary constant temperature and flow gas.
